What Does This Mean?
This verse is from Paul to the Colossians. It tells believers they should live in a way that pleases God, do good works, and grow in their understanding of Him.

Historical Background
The letter was written by Paul around 60-62 AD to a community in Colossae. It aimed to counter false teachings and strengthen their faith through understanding Christ as central.
